Abstract
To find out low temperature tolerant genetic resources, 1000 accessions of tossa jute (Corchorus olitorius L.) were studied through their seed germina tion at 16 degrees C and other related growth parameters. Out of 1000 acces sions 13 were identified with low temperature tolerance. Base temperature o f four selected accessions 1540, 1805, 1852 and 2015 and two cultivars, O-4 and O-9897 were determined as 16.0, 15.5, 17.5, 16.5, 22.5 and 21.5 degree s C respectively. The growth parameters of the accessions grown in pots in a growth chamber at 16 degrees C were recorded. Only the selected accession s emerged on the sixth day after sowing (DAS) where, the cultivars failed t o germinate at that low temperature. The primary root length of 2015 was fo und to be higher than those of other three accessions at all the stages of growth. Maximum shoot length was obtained in 1805 at 35 DAS and highest dry weight/plant was also recorded in 1805.
